The English language is overflowing with rich, nuanced terms, and today, we’re diving into the delightful word “serendipitous.” It’s not just a fancy word to toss around; it captures a profound concept that resonates with many life experiences. Imagine this: you're rummaging through your attic, looking for that old soccer ball, and you unexpectedly stumble upon a treasure trove of childhood photos. That, my friend, is serendipity in action!

The SAT often pokes and prods at our understanding of words like this, and recognizing “serendipitous” can give you an edge. It’s that perfect term for those moments when life throws unexpected goodness your way. When something beneficial happens purely by luck, we call it serendipitous. Contrast that with our options: “foreboding,” “intentional,” and “oblivious.” Can you see how they just don’t fit the bill?

Let’s break these down for clarity, shall we? First up, “foreboding” – picture that ominous storm cloud looming over you. It’s a word drenched in dread and anticipation of something sinister. Clearly, that’s miles away from a happy accident. Next, there’s “intentional,” which stands firmly in the arena of purpose and planning. It’s like saying you set out to find that treasure in your attic; that’s deliberate, not accidental. Then we’ve got “oblivious,” a state of sheer unawareness. Think of someone blissfully unaware of the crumbs all over their shirt—plenty unaware, but lacking that sweet serendipity.
